HOW WILL THE PROGRAMME WORK?You will be based at Severn Trent Headquarters in Coventry, the heart of our patch.
In this exciting programme, you will have the chance to discuss your development and career ambitions in your 1-1 meetings with business leads, mentors, a study buddy, the cohort leader, and the New Talent Team.
WHAT YOU WILL LEARN- How to access and analyse data from across the entire business. Using it to update existing dashboards and reports, as well as creating your own to meet any new requirements.
- How to effectively clean, transform, join and validate data from multiple sources (including solving any problems that arise as part of that). Ensuring your data, visualisations, reports, and any conclusions you draw from them are accurate.
- How to carry out analysis on key measures such as how effectively a team or project is performing right through to higher level company performance metrics that are reported to the water regulatory body OFWAT.
- To build internal relationships that foster buy-in to existing and future initiatives.
- To understand how to act ethically and how this thought process can be brought into everyday business practices.
- How to analyse and identify Severn Trent’s opportunities and threats. Escalating any risks within your own team or processes if you find them.
